Antifreeze mixtures for winter use explained

Frederick W. Ives of the agricultural engineering department at Ohio State University outlines an alcohol based antifreeze approach for autos and gasoline engines. He details strength by temperature with 10 20 30 and 85 percent solutions and warns that higher concentrations may form a soft mush and that special blends often contain harmful chemicals.

Soldiers' Relief Commission Finalizes 1915 Accounts

The Soldiers' Relief Commission met in the auditor's office last Saturday and closed the year 1915 with a balance of 67.75 dollars. Board members J. B. Holmes Williamsburg Frank Stahl Goshen and Truman Markley Williamsville will revise the pensioner relief list for those who only receive pensions and own no home or property.

Busy Farmers Week at Ohio State University

About 2000 farmers from across the state attend Farm ers Week at Ohio State University the first week in February. Programs run 13 hours daily with six sessions per hour plus institutes and events by dairymen livestock breeders and vegetable growers. Governor Willis speaks February 3 and Dewey Hanes of Arcanum showcases How I Raise Corn and Wheat on February 2.

Overweight Hauling Sparks Adams County Road Damage Case

Adams County authorities file damage proceedings against Farmers' Warehouse Co of West Union for hauling three hogs heads over the weight limit to Manchester. County says overloads harm road beds. many residents contributed to roadwork at no cost, and the case proceeds in court.

Representative Kearns seeks Ensign rank for Loren Greeno

Washington January 8 Representative Kearns introduced a bill to grant the rank and emoluments of Ensign in the Navy to Loren Walden Greeno of Milford Ohio Greeno a 1908 Annapolis graduate was discharged before completing postgraduate work due to Brights disease He is a brother of Mrs Will Keen of Clermont Ohio.
